Diagnostic Description
provided by Fishbase
Differentiated by its relatively tall neural spines in the caudal vertebrae, shorter caudal peduncle (26.0% SL versus 30.7-36.8), longer snout (35.5% HL versus 27.2-34.1), more wide-set eyes (interorbital distance 30.9% HL versus 27.2-34.1), fewer vertebrae (42 versus 44-45), and smooth (versus serrated) dorsal spine (Ref. 45707).

Morphology
provided by Fishbase
Dorsal spines (total): 1; Dorsal soft rays (total): 5; Analspines: 0; Analsoft rays: 10; Vertebrae: 42

Breitensteinia hypselurus: Brief Summary
provided by wikipedia EN
Breitensteinia hypselurus is a species of catfish of the family Akysidae. A detailed discussion of this species's relationship with the other species in the genus can be found at Breitensteinia.
